The effects of pay transparency on motivation and performance

Learning how your salary compares to your peers can result in a negative reaction if you earn less than anticipated, leading to decreased work hours and email communication. Conversely, discovering that you earn more than anticipated can elicit a positive response, motivating employees to work longer, sell more, and work harder. When individuals learn what their boss earns, they often underestimate their boss's salary. However, discovering that their boss earns more than expected is seen as positive news and is highly motivating, leading to increased dedication and effort in the workplace.
